Standard Omeprazole Dosage for Acid Reflux

For adults experiencing acid reflux symptoms, the typical omeprazole dosage is 20mg once daily, taken in the morning before food [1]. This dose effectively suppresses gastric acid production for up to 24 hours in most patients, providing relief from heartburn, regurgitation, and chest discomfort.

In clinical trials, 20mg omeprazole demonstrated healing rates of 80-90% for erosive oesophagitis within 4-8 weeks of treatment [1]. For milder symptoms or maintenance therapy, a 10mg daily dose may be sufficient, whilst severe cases occasionally require 40mg daily under prescriber supervision [2].

The MHRA-approved treatment duration for over-the-counter omeprazole is up to 4 weeks. If symptoms persist beyond this period, a UK prescriber should reassess your condition to rule out underlying pathology and determine whether continued treatment is appropriate.

When to Take Omeprazole for Maximum Effectiveness

Omeprazole works best when taken 30-60 minutes before your first meal of the day, typically breakfast [1]. This timing allows the medication to reach peak concentration in your bloodstream when your stomach's proton pumps are most active, maximising acid suppression throughout the day.

Avoid taking omeprazole with food, as this can reduce absorption by up to 35% and delay symptom relief [2]. Swallow capsules whole with water — do not chew or crush them, as the enteric coating protects the active ingredient from stomach acid degradation.

Adjusting Your Omeprazole Dosage Safely

Dosage adjustments should always be made under guidance from a UK prescriber. If 20mg omeprazole provides insufficient relief after 2 weeks, your clinician may increase the dose to 40mg daily or switch you to an alternative proton pump inhibitor with different pharmacokinetics [3].

Conversely, once symptoms are controlled for 4-8 weeks, many patients successfully step down to 10mg daily for maintenance therapy. Some individuals achieve symptom control with on-demand dosing, taking omeprazole only when reflux symptoms occur [3].

Never exceed 40mg daily without prescriber approval. Elderly patients and those with severe liver impairment may require dose reduction, as omeprazole metabolism can be significantly prolonged in these populations [4].

Whilst omeprazole 20mg is the reference standard for PPI therapy, alternative medications offer different dosing profiles that may suit individual patient needs. Lansoprazole 30mg provides comparable efficacy to omeprazole 20mg, with some studies suggesting slightly faster onset of action [5].

Esomeprazole, the S-isomer of omeprazole, achieves superior acid suppression at 20mg compared to omeprazole 20mg due to improved bioavailability [5]. Pantoprazole 40mg offers similar efficacy to omeprazole 20mg but with a longer half-life, potentially benefiting patients with nocturnal acid breakthrough.

Your UK prescriber will consider factors including symptom severity, previous treatment response, drug interactions, and cost when recommending the most appropriate PPI and dosage for your acid reflux management.

How Long Should You Take Omeprazole for Acid Reflux?

Short-term omeprazole therapy (2-4 weeks) is appropriate for occasional acid reflux triggered by dietary indiscretion or lifestyle factors. Most patients experience significant symptom improvement within 1-3 days of starting treatment [1].

For gastro-oesophageal reflux disease (GORD) with documented oesophagitis, an 8-week course at 20mg daily is typically required for complete mucosal healing [2]. Following successful healing, many patients transition to maintenance therapy at the lowest effective dose.

Long-term PPI use beyond 12 months should be reviewed regularly by a UK prescriber. Whilst omeprazole has an excellent safety profile, extended treatment has been associated with small increases in risks including bone fractures, vitamin B12 deficiency, and Clostridium difficile infection in susceptible individuals [4]. Your clinician will weigh these considerations against the benefits of continued therapy.

Reducing or Stopping Omeprazole Treatment

When discontinuing omeprazole after prolonged use, some patients experience rebound acid hypersecretion — a temporary increase in stomach acid production that can cause symptom recurrence [6]. This physiological response typically resolves within 2-4 weeks.

To minimise rebound symptoms, your prescriber may recommend gradual dose reduction, stepping down from 20mg to 10mg for 2 weeks before stopping completely. Implementing lifestyle modifications such as weight management, avoiding trigger foods, and elevating the head of your bed can support successful treatment discontinuation.

Omeprazole Dosage for Special Populations

Pregnant and breastfeeding women experiencing acid reflux should consult a UK prescriber before taking omeprazole. Whilst limited data suggest omeprazole is relatively safe during pregnancy, it should only be used when benefits clearly outweigh potential risks [4].

Children and adolescents require weight-based dosing calculated by a specialist. The typical paediatric omeprazole dosage ranges from 0.7-3.3mg per kilogram of body weight daily, depending on age and indication, with a maximum of 40mg daily [4].

Patients with severe liver cirrhosis (Child-Pugh Class C) should not exceed 10-20mg daily, as omeprazole clearance may be reduced by up to 70% in advanced hepatic impairment [4]. Renal impairment does not typically require dose adjustment, as omeprazole is primarily metabolised hepatically.

Common Omeprazole Dosing Mistakes to Avoid

Taking omeprazole at bedtime is a frequent error that significantly reduces efficacy. Because proton pumps are most active during daytime eating, evening dosing provides suboptimal acid suppression when you need it most [1].

Another common mistake is expecting immediate relief. Unlike antacids that neutralise existing stomach acid within minutes, omeprazole requires 2-3 days to achieve full therapeutic effect as it gradually inhibits proton pump activity [2]. Patients should continue treatment as prescribed even if symptoms don't resolve immediately.

Splitting or crushing omeprazole capsules destroys the enteric coating, exposing the active ingredient to stomach acid degradation and rendering the medication ineffective. If you have difficulty swallowing capsules, ask your UK prescriber about dispersible tablet formulations or alternative PPIs available as orodispersible tablets.

Drug Interactions Affecting Omeprazole Dosage

Omeprazole is metabolised by the CYP2C19 enzyme system, creating potential interactions with medications including clopidogrel, warfarin, diazepam, and phenytoin [4]. Your UK prescriber will review your complete medication list to identify interactions that may require dose adjustment or alternative therapy.

Conversely, omeprazole's acid-suppressing effect can reduce absorption of pH-dependent medications such as ketoconazole, iron supplements, and certain HIV antiretrovirals [4]. Timing adjustments or alternative formulations may be necessary to maintain efficacy of these concurrent treatments.

Should I take omeprazole in the morning or at night?
Omeprazole should be taken in the morning, 30-60 minutes before breakfast. Morning dosing provides optimal acid suppression throughout the day when reflux symptoms typically occur, as proton pumps are most active during eating.
How long does omeprazole take to work for acid reflux?
Most patients notice symptom improvement within 1-3 days of starting omeprazole, but full therapeutic effect requires 4-5 days of consistent dosing. Complete healing of oesophageal inflammation may take 4-8 weeks depending on severity.
Is 10mg omeprazole enough for mild acid reflux?
For mild, intermittent acid reflux symptoms, 10mg omeprazole daily may provide adequate relief. This lower dose is also used for maintenance therapy after initial symptom control with 20mg, subject to prescriber guidance.
Can I take omeprazole only when I have heartburn?
On-demand dosing (taking omeprazole only when symptoms occur) can be effective for some patients with mild, infrequent reflux after initial symptom control. However, this approach requires prescriber approval and may not suit everyone.
What happens if I miss a dose of omeprazole?
If you miss your morning omeprazole dose, take it as soon as you remember on the same day. If it's almost time for your next dose, skip the missed dose and continue your regular schedule — never double up to compensate.
